testo Saveris Converter
By connecting a testo Saveris
Converter to an Ethernet socket, the
signal from a wireless probe can be
converted into an Ethernet signal. This
combines the flexible installation of a
wireless probe with the exploitation of
the existing Ethernet even over long
transmission distances.

testo Saveris wireless probes
Probe versions with internal as well
as external temperature and humidity
sensors allow the adaptation to any
application. The wireless probes are
available optionally with or without
display. The current measurement
data, the battery status and the quality
of the wireless connection are shown.
Humidity and dierential pressure transmitters
testo 6651/6681/6351/6381/6383
The integration of the humidity and differential pressure
transmitters allows control parallel to the measurement data
monitoring. This offers the solution for highest accuracy
as well as for special applications (high humidity, trace
humidity etc.) in compressed air, drying and air conditioning
technology.
testo Saveris Router
The use of a Router can improve or
extend the wireless connection in
difficult constructional circumstances.
Several Routers in the testo Saveris
system are of course possible. At the
same time, the serial switching of up
to 3 Routers V 2.0 provides the highest
level of flexibility regarding wireless
range.
testo Saveris Analog Coupler
The two versions of the Analog Coupler (wireless/Ethernet)
allow the integration of further measurement parameters
into the testo Saveris monitoring system, by including all
transmitters with standardized current/voltage interfaces,
e.g. 4 to 20 mA or 0 to 10 V.
